gpt4 book ai didi

amazon-s3 - 使用特定前缀的过滤器使用 aws-cli 从 S3 下载

转载 作者:行者123 更新时间:2023-12-02 22:17:59 34 4
gpt4 key购买 nike

由于某种原因,有一个存储桶,里面有一堆不同的文件,所有这些文件都具有相同的前缀,但日期不同:

backup.2017-01-01aa

backup.2017-01-01ab

backup.2017-01-15aa

backup.2017-01-15ab

backup.2017-02-01aa

backup.2017-02-01ab

etc..

如何下载以“backup.2017-01-01”开头的文件?

最佳答案

我认为--include在本地进行过滤。因此,如果您的存储桶包含数百万个文件,则该命令可能需要几个小时才能运行,因为它需要下载存储桶中所有文件名的列表。此外,还有一些额外的网络流量。

但是aws s3 ls可以使用截断的文件名来列出所有相应的文件,而不需要任何额外的流量。所以你可以

aws s3 ls s3://yourbucket/backup.2017-

查看您的文件,以及类似的内容

aws s3 ls s3://yourbucket/backup.2017- | colrm 1 31 | xargs -I % aws s3 cp s3://yourbucket/% .

复制您的文件。

关于amazon-s3 - 使用特定前缀的过滤器使用 aws-cli 从 S3 下载,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/45301240/

34 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com